News Breaks | | | | September 21, 2012 | | 09:01 EDT |  | ORB | Orbital Sciences awarded $26M contract by U.S. Navy for seven Coyote SSST Orbital Sciences announced that it was recently awarded a production contract for seven Coyote supersonic sea-skimming target, or SSST, vehicles and related equipment by the U.S. Navy. The latest order for Orbital's Coyote target program is in addition to existing production contracts for the Mach 2.5-capable, low-altitude target missile used by the Navy to test fleet self-defense systems against a threat-representative target. This latest SSST order is the sixth full-rate production contract following a highly successful five-year development and flight test program. The total value of the new contract is $26.4M. | |
